Fancy a Dada game?

Inspired by the Dada movement, which formed in Zurich after the First World War, immigrants from Germany and other countries created art to express a new, anti-war mentality. Characteristics of Dadaism include spontaneity, absurdity, and artistic freedom. The movement was an emotional reaction to the times. And here's how it works:

Grab a dictionary or another book, open it to any page, and choose a word at random to letter. You can make the game more interesting by using a book in another language and translating the words to, for example, write a poem. You get bonus points for drawing the words.

Reflect on the words you just wrote:

What do these words mean to you?

Did you turn it into a poem?

How did this exercise inspire you?
